Overview
ubitricity develops a virtual charging network that enables every electric socket to serve as a charging point for electric cars. The company is assembling and integrating backend processes—user authentication, meter data collection and billing—in cooperation with providers of remote meter reading, energy data management and billing services. Its platform integrates these pieces to let users securely charge vehicles at any location en route. The €1.8M Series A financing will fund development of the missing pieces and conclude system and process integration. As part of the round, Earlybird’s Wolfgang Seibold will join ubitricity’s supervisory board. The company was founded in 2008 and is based in Berlin, Germany.
